Who owns this Site?

Undercover Lovers is a member of the Interactive Dating and Entertainment Limited (“IDE”) Partners Network. The Interactive Dating and Entertainment Limited Partners Network is the white label dating division of Interactive Dating and Entertainment Limited (Company Number 04473833) and has its registered office at IDE Ltd, 50 Long Acre, London WC2E 9JR. It is important that you understand these terms are a binding legal agreement between you and IDE including any of the IDE Group of companies who help IDE to fulfil its obligations under these terms.

What are the Services?

IDE provides online social, entertainment and associated services through the Site that enables you to contact and talk with other members and to participate in online events hosted on the Site (the 'Services').

IDE creates user profiles for use by our customer support representatives for the support, marketing and improvement of the Services. IDE's customer support representatives are encouraged to speak to members and also stimulate conversation between members by making introductions and recommendations. They may, from time to time, send electronic communications to ask how their members are using certain aspects of the Services. This is a vital part of the Services IDE provide.

Do you continue to bill me automatically when my membership ends?

Yes - we operate a repeat billing policy. This means that once your initial membership period has expired, for your convenience, your membership will automatically be renewed at the same rate that you signed up for.

We reserve the right to alter our packages at any time and any change in your subscription price will be notified to you at least 7 days prior to the new subscription price being implemented. Rebilling will occur only when your current payment period expires and not before.

I’m in the UK – tell me about my 7 day cancellation right?

Under the United Kingdom Consumer Protection (Distance Selling) Regulations 2000, you can cancel the agreement created through your acceptance of these terms of use within 7 working days after the confirmation of your subscription to any Services and receive a full refund. However, if you use the Services in any manner after your subscription, you will lose your cancellation right. Use of the Services means sending to or receiving from other members and any communication, viewing photos of other members, or making changes to your profile or information on your account.
